WebCross Crawl Cross Crawl accesses both brain hemispheres simultaneously, and stimulates receptive as well as expressive hemispheres of the brain, facilitating integration. Instructions- In this contralateral exercise, similar to walking in place, the participant alternately moves one arm and its opposite leg and the other arm and its opposite leg. WebSimple Drills. A cross lateral movement may be as easy as touching the left foot with the right hand from a standing position. Opposite hand to knee or to ear also count as cross lateral movements....

WebThere are three main benefits of bilateral exercises. 1) First, it is the best way to develop absolute strength. Since more muscles are used in the movement and balance tends to not be a limitation, you can create more intensity and lift heavier weights. 2) Second, it’s a great way to develop motor control in the bend and squat movement patterns.
